titleOfInvention Exhaust gas purifying device, exhaust gas purifying material, and method of manufacturing exhaust gas purifying material
abstract (57) [PROBLEMS] To prevent a NOx absorbent that absorbs NOx in exhaust gas from being poisoned by sulfur compounds in the exhaust gas. SOLUTION: NOx in exhaust gas is absorbed in the presence of oxygen, and when the oxygen concentration of the exhaust gas decreases, N2 is released. A layer 26 containing an Ox absorber and a layer 2 containing a sulfur compound absorber that absorbs sulfur compounds in the exhaust gas in the presence of oxygen and releases it when the oxygen concentration of the exhaust gas decreases 8 is supported on the carrier 25 in a layered manner so that the former is on the inside and the latter is on the outside, and the NOx absorbent of the inner layer 26 is protected from sulfur oxides in the exhaust gas by the sulfur compound absorbent of the outer layer 28. I do.
